How to Fix Myself Emotionally
Emotional well-being is crucial for leading a fulfilling life. However, many of us face challenges in maintaining emotional stability and dealing with the stresses of daily life. If you find yourself struggling with emotional issues, it’s essential to take proactive steps to fix yourself emotionally. This article will provide you with practical tips and strategies to help you overcome emotional challenges and improve your overall well-being.
1. Acknowledge Your Emotions
The first step in fixing yourself emotionally is to acknowledge your emotions. It’s important to understand that it’s normal to experience a range of emotions, including happiness, sadness, anger, and anxiety. By recognizing and accepting your emotions, you can start to address the root causes of your emotional turmoil.
2. Seek Professional Help
If you’re struggling to cope with your emotions, seeking the help of a mental health professional can be beneficial. A therapist or counselor can provide you with personalized strategies to manage your emotions and help you develop healthy coping mechanisms. Don’t hesitate to reach out for support when needed.
3. Practice Self-Care
Self-care is essential for emotional well-being. Make sure to prioritize activities that promote relaxation and reduce stress, such as exercise, meditation, and hobbies. Additionally, ensure you’re getting enough sleep, eating a balanced diet, and staying hydrated. These simple steps can significantly improve your emotional health.
4. Set Realistic Goals
Setting realistic goals can help you stay focused and motivated. Break down your larger goals into smaller, manageable tasks, and celebrate your progress along the way. Remember that change takes time, and it’s essential to be patient with yourself.
5. Build a Support System
Surrounding yourself with supportive friends and family members can make a significant difference in your emotional well-being. Share your feelings with trusted individuals who can offer empathy, encouragement, and advice. Don’t isolate yourself; seek out social connections that can provide emotional support.
6. Practice Mindfulness and Meditation
Mindfulness and meditation are effective tools for managing emotions and reducing stress. These practices help you stay present and focused on the moment, allowing you to let go of negative thoughts and worries. Dedicate a few minutes each day to practice mindfulness and meditation, and you’ll likely notice improvements in your emotional health.
7. Learn to Forgive and Let Go
Holding onto past grievances can be emotionally draining. Learning to forgive and let go of negative experiences can help you move forward and find peace. Practice compassion for yourself and others, and understand that it’s essential to let go of the past to heal and grow.
8. Reflect on Your Thoughts
Your thoughts can significantly impact your emotions. Reflect on the negative thoughts that may be contributing to your emotional challenges and challenge their validity. Replace negative thoughts with positive affirmations and focus on the things you’re grateful for in your life.
9. Embrace Change
Change is a natural part of life, and embracing it can help you adapt to new situations and reduce emotional stress. Develop resilience by facing challenges head-on and learning from your experiences. Remember that change is an opportunity for growth and self-improvement.
10. Continue to Grow and Learn
Emotional healing is an ongoing process. Continue to educate yourself on emotional well-being, read self-help books, and attend workshops or seminars. By continuously learning and growing, you’ll be better equipped to manage your emotions and maintain your emotional well-being.
